# Valletta, Malta

Valletta, the capital of Malta, is a UNESCO World Heritage site and a living museum of Baroque architecture. This compact city, founded by the Knights of St. John in the 16th century, boasts stunning views of the Mediterranean Sea from its fortified walls. Valletta's narrow streets are lined with historic buildings, charming cafes, and boutique shops, offering visitors a unique blend of history and modern culture.

## Common questions

**What's the best time to visit Valletta?**

The best time to visit Valletta is during spring (April to June) or autumn (September to November) when the weather is mild and there are fewer tourists.

**How many days should I spend in Valletta?**

While you can see the main attractions in a day, spending 2-3 days in Valletta allows for a more relaxed exploration of the city and its surroundings.

**Is Valletta walkable?**

Yes, Valletta is very walkable. The city is small and compact, making it easy to explore on foot. However, be prepared for some steep streets and stairs.

**What's the local currency in Valletta?**

The currency used in Valletta, and throughout Malta, is the Euro (€).

**Are there any beaches near Valletta?**

While there are no beaches in Valletta itself, nearby beaches can be easily reached by bus or ferry. Popular options include St. George's Bay, Golden Bay, and Mellieha Bay.
